Identified as Claudio Agretti (called Aigroz or Aigrot), famous canon of Bruges and papal ambassador (internuncius). Reference: Inscriptions funéraires et monumentales de la Flandre, Volumes 1-2 (also in Google Books). He was born in Dole on December 8, 1636 (during the siege of the city) and died in Bruges on November 14, 1724. Graduated in civil and canon law.
